Ingredients and seasonings must exist in prepare
  1. Take 1 medium Sweet potato
  2. Prepare 2 tbsp ★Olive oil
  3. Prepare 3 tbsp ★ Sugar (if possible, soft light brown sugar)
  4. Prepare 1 tsp ★ Mentsuyu (2x concentrate)
  5. Prepare 1/2 tsp ★Vinegar
  6. Use 2 tbsp ★Water
  7. Prepare 1 Black sesame seeds (optional)

Step by step to make Non-Fried Daigaku Imo Sweet Potatoes:
  1. Wash the sweet potatoes. Roughly chop into 5-6 cm long, slightly thin slices.
  2. Put the slices into a bowl and soak in water. Drain.
  3. Put the ★ ingredients into a frying pan and lightly mix together. Spread the ingredients out in the pan (this is to even out the flavor). Put the sweet potatoes on top, cover with a lid, turn on the heat, and steam-cook.
  4. When it comes to a boil, flip the potatoes occasionally (for about 15 minutes).
  5. When you can easily press a skewer through the potatoes, take off the lid. Coat the potatoes with the sauce as the water evaporates.
  6. Transfer to a plate and sprinkle black sesame seeds on top. Enjoy!
